The cultivated land resource is short in China and the number of medium-low yielded farmland islarge, especially in Northeast, medium-low yielded farmland area accounted for65%of the region’sarable land. With increasing pressure on food security, our country has become increasingly urgent toexplore the potential of medium-low yielded farmland, to introduce relevant documents and policiesabout comprehensive management of medium-low yielded farmland for many years.This research mainly done the following work: at the county provincial level, making use of unitarea yield of grain method and obstacle factor method to study spatial distribution of northeastmedium-low yielded farmland; using the method of unit area yield of grain to calculate medium-lowyielded farmland numbers and portions in different periods according to county data of northeast in1990-2010. Combining ArcGIS to draw the medium-low yielded farmland space distribution in differentperiods, analyze changing trend of medium-low yielded farmland quantity, spatial and causes; takeFuxin Mongolian autonomous county in Liaoning province for example to build medium-low yieldedfarmland comprehensive governance model.1. medium-low yielded farmland area in northeast by unit area yield of grain method, obstaclefactor method and land fertility grade method was1204.97,1613.45,2208.62ten thousand hectaresrespectively, accounting for65.19%,65%, and99.5%of the statistical total.Unit area yield of grainmethod is a relative concept; Obstacles method is an absolute concept.2. The medium-low yielded farmland of the northeast was divided into stains waterlogging, poortype, erosion, salt, sand and other types according to obstacle factor method at provincial level. Theproportion accounted for middle and low yielded fields were24.9%,15.2%,32.3%,15.2%,6.4%and5.0%respectively. The medium-low yielded farmland of Heilongjiang erosion, stains waterlogging andsaline accounted for the largest proportion; The medium-low yielded farmland area in Jilin was3.6111million hectares, the poor type accounted for the largest proportion; The medium-low yielded farmlandarea in Liaoning province was3.4639million hectares, poor and erosion type accounted for the largestproportion.3. County data indicated that middle yielded farmland mainly distributed in the central Songnenplains, the west Liaohe plain area, southern Liaodong peninsula and the Sanjiang plain. Low yieldedfarmland mainly distributed in the northwest of Heilongjiang, northeast east mountainous area and inSanjiang plain, rendering the flake continuous distribution with larger area.4. Medium and low yield farmland area portions fluctuated within a certain range, and its totalportion was63.8%-67.1%. High, medium and low production area presented a layer structure in spacevariation, the high-yield area core moved to the northeastward gradually, medium-yield area expandedto the peripheral low-yield area, which resulted in reducing of low yield area. Medium and low yieldedfarmland converted to each other under the influence of external factors, but the medium and low yieldfarmland area was not easily converted to the high yield area. 5. The "deep-straw returning on deep-coated" comprehensive governance model was summed upagainst the problems in medium-low yielded farmland. This model shows good results in soil fertilitycultivation, soil and water conservation, production promotion.
